You are looking at a 1967 Ford Mustang S Code Lone Star Limited package mustang. These cars are also referred to as Blue Bonnet Specials. They were promotional cars for Texas dealers only. They were painted that color blue because of the Texas Bluebonnet flower. Only 175 Lone Star Limited mustangs were made, and according the Marti statistics, this is the only 390 coupe auto coupe made, and possibly the only one made as an S code. Very rare Car.

This car was sold new at Bill Utter Ford, in Denton Texas. The Car then was owned by a man in Wichita Falls, TX who used it as a street/strip car and put a dual quad 2x4 427 Ford FE engine in the car. The car went to California for about 7 months in 2020 and then here to WV just recently.
